What is surging in centrifugal compressor. how its happened
and how to avoid it.?
Answer Posted / engineer muhammad masoom shafi
Surging is a momentary back flow through the compressor from
the discharge to the suction.This can occur when the mass
flow of gas to the compressor falls below a critical level
with a high pressure difference across the m/c.when there is
not enough gas to replace that being pushed
Forward,discharge gas will flow backwards through the
compressor towards the suction side this back flow will tend
to decrease the speed of rotation while the speed controller
will try to maintain the correct speed.the gas flowing
backward provides more volume to the suction side and the
compressor picks up and begins to push gas forward again.the
m/c speed will tend to increase and the governor will again
try to maintain the correct,set speed.all of this take place
very quickly,the forward and backward gas flow together with
the speed control action cause rapid fluctuation in the flow
and pressure in the system.this surging condition is similar
to an aircraft'stall'condition,or pump cavitation.
